Analysis
In 2024, total fisheries production (metric tons), annual growth rate in Euro area stood at 0.2956 % change on previous year.
The figure is up 106.5% on the previous year and down 95.6% over ten years.
Over the whole period, total fisheries production (metric tons), annual growth rate in Euro area peaked at 11.28 % change on previous year in 1992 and was at its lowest, -8.44 % change on previous year, in 2020.
That places Euro area 32nd out of 47 groups with data for 2024, putting it in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
The year-on-year percentage change in Total fisheries production (metric tons). Computed from consecutive annual observations; years either side of a gap are skipped rather than bridged.
Computed from
- Total fisheries production Food and Agriculture Organization., Food and Agriculture Organization of the United Nations (FAO), publisher: Food and Agriculture Organization of the United Nations (FAO)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
